Based on the data from 1997 when the population of Comstock, Michigan was 13,383

Number of Establishments per 100,000 population

  • A) Manufacturing: 1997 - 17 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 127, State average - 61)
  • B) Wholesale trade: 1997 - 16 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 119, State average - 35)
  • C) Retail trade: 1997 - 30 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 224, State average - 106)
  • D) Real estate & rental & leasing: 1997 - 6 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 44, State average - 24)
  • E) Professional, scientific & technical services: 1997 - 13 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 97, State average - 65)
  • F) Administrative & support & waste management & remediation service: 1997 - 6 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 44, State average - 30)
  • G) Health care & social assistance: 1997 - 13 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 97, State average - 72)
  • H) Arts, entertainment & recreation: 1997 - 4 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 29, State average - 7)
  • I) Accommodation & food services: 1997 - 15 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 112, State average - 52)
  • J) Other services (except public administration): 1997 - 15 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 112, State average - 49)
